The Negros Museum Highlights: Must-See Features and Attractions
Some information may have been translated by Google Translate
The Negros Museum is located in a neoclassical building built in 1930. The museum mainly displays the rich history of Negros Island, the development of the sugar industry, from the Spanish colonial period to sugar cane cultivation, to the independent revolution, in In the exhibition hall, you can see replicas of a sugar cane locomotive and a cargo ship, as well as some local taxidermy of endangered animals.
